We were crossing fingers that we’d make it clean into 2010 without another dubious Apple Tablet rumor, but our dreams were vanquished today thanks to one Yair Reiner. The Oppenheimer analyst had some new predictions on the upcoming Apple Tablet and somehow it’s managed to lose tech while gaining price.

According to Yair, Apple is preparing to begin production on up to 1,000 tablets a month and will likely look to release the device in March or April of next year. Instead of the OLED that was part of previous rumors, the tablet will get a cheaper 10.1-inch LTPS LCD multi-touch display. It’ll also get a price tag of $1,000–on the upper end of previous reports and pretty steep by any measure.

The new rumor also indicates that Apple is working on an attractive deal with publishers that would give a 30/70 split (30% for Apple) without the exclusivity demanded by Amazon.

Another day, another rumor and then we wait…[via Fortune]
